CHOCOLATE COCONUT PROTEIN MUFFINS

INGREDIENTS


2 cup Kodiak cakes powder cakes Dark Chocolate

2 scoops Chocolate protein powder

1 whole egg

6oz Fair Life fat free milk

1/2 cup nonfat plain greek yogurt

4 Tbsp shredded coconut flakes

6 tsp cane sugar

2 tsp coconut extract






DIRECTIONS


1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Place muffin liners in a muffin tin and spray lightly with non-stick cooking spray.

2. In a small bowl, mix together kodiak cakes, protein powder, and coconut flakes. Set aside.

3. In a medium size bowl, whisk egg. Add milk, yogurt, sugar, and coconut extract and mix. Add dry ingredients to wet ingredients and combine well.

4. Fill each muffin liner evenly.

5. Place in oven and bake for 19-21 minutes.
